How they compare
Chile currently reports 0.0164 kt against 0.0106 kt in Mexico, a difference of 0.0058 kt.
That makes Chile's figure about 1.5 times Mexico's.
The two have swapped places 3 times across 34 shared years of data; in 1990 it was Mexico ahead.
Chile ranks 20th and Mexico ranks 23rd of 120 countries.
Across the 4 decades both report, Chile averaged higher in 1 and Mexico in 3.
Head to head by decade
| Decade | Chile | Mexico |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 0.0036 kt | 0.0244 kt | 0.0208 kt | Mexico |
| 2000s | 0.0054 kt | 0.0199 kt | 0.0145 kt | Mexico |
| 2010s | 0.0123 kt | 0.0136 kt | 0.0012 kt | Mexico |
| 2020s | 0.0163 kt | 0.0106 kt | 0.0057 kt | Chile |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
